In-house video manufacturing includes creating video clip content making use of a business's interior group and resources. Greater control over the production process and brand messaging. Faster turn-around times for modifications and project conclusion. Cost-effective for organizations with ongoing video clip material needs. Needs significant financial investment in devices, innovation, and competent employees. May lack customized experience in particular facets of video clip manufacturing.
Outsourced video clip manufacturing involves employing external firms or freelancers to produce video clip web content. Access to seasoned professionals with specialized abilities and proficiency. Greater innovative input and fresh perspectives on jobs. Scalability and versatility to manage tasks of differing dimensions and complexities. Greater expenses compared to internal production, especially for smaller jobs.
Longer timelines due to control with external groups. How do you attract the best clients without counting on big swaths of web traffic? The straightforward solution is to connect with people that remain in the market for our solutions. When you locate a company or organization that has a requirement, you have actually reduced your sales join in fifty percent. For instance, my initial customer at first denied my sales pitch.
I was eager for job samples to develop out my profile, so I supplied to do a task totally free. I completed that task, he rolled the video clip out, and instantly he had a wealth of applicants. His opinion on the worth of video rapidly changed, and within a month agreed on a year-long agreement to produce a selection of video material.
My manufacturing kit was developed out to be lean, nimble, and efficient. I favored smaller sized video cameras, small illumination remedies, and aimed to fit my whole manufacturing kit right into a backpack.
I spent a considerable quantity of time championing that method to my prospective customers by positioning myself as a lean and reliable alternative to the "three ring circus" that a lot of them experienced with past video manufacturing jobs that they had participated in. It is necessary to note that the success of this approach rests on delivering a first-class finished product.
If your deliverables fade in contrast, after that they will aim to your production style as the offender. As soon as the pandemic hit in 2020, my sales pitch concerning a "tiny impact" was a lot less pertinent when everyone was searching for "no footprint."So as we listened to consumers throughout that time, we observed a common theme with feedback was, "how a lot simpler [we] made [their] jobs really feel." Making video clip production simpler and more smooth resonated with our clients, so our philosophy as a service began leaning a lot more into that.
Being receptive to changing conditions will assist you wade with uncharted region and expand your organization gradually.
